

7. 'A bit of a fixer-upper' - DHS and the botched launch of Robodebt
Jul 1, 2023
This episode discusses the overwhelmed state of public servants during the backlash against Robodebt and the unlawfulness, immorality, and inaccuracy of the program. It explores the media strategy, controversy surrounding personal data release, and defending the program. It also highlights internal issues, lack of risk assessment, and the mismatch between internal actions and public perception.
